Invoice Guru vs ProcessBankStatement
Side-by-side comparison to help you choose the right tool.
Invoice Guru
Invoice Guru empowers UK tradespeople to create compliant invoices in under a minute, simplifying on-site billing.
Last updated: February 28, 2026
ProcessBankStatement
Transform your PDF bank statements into organized CSV files in seconds with unmatched speed, accuracy, and security for effortless data management.
Last updated: March 19, 2026
Visual Comparison
Invoice Guru

ProcessBankStatement

Feature Comparison
Invoice Guru
Instant Invoice Creation
With Invoice Guru, users can create and send professional invoices in less than a minute. The app allows for quick entry of client details and items, and automatically includes key information such as logos, VAT, payment terms, and due dates, ensuring a polished and professional presentation every time.
Automatic Invoice Numbering
This feature ensures that invoices are automatically numbered and dated according to the user's fiscal year settings. It eliminates the need for manual tracking and organization, providing users with peace of mind that their invoicing is orderly and compliant with accounting standards.
OCR Receipt Scanner (AI)
The integrated AI-powered OCR receipt scanner allows users to capture and digitize their receipts by simply taking a photo. The app reads all relevant details and saves them as expense entries, thus eliminating the tedious manual data entry process and ensuring accurate expense tracking.
Smart Payment Tracking
Invoice Guru automatically matches incoming bank transactions with outstanding invoices, providing users with visibility into their payment statuses. It clearly indicates which clients have paid and which invoices are overdue, simplifying the cash flow management process for small businesses.
ProcessBankStatement
Instant Bank Statement Conversion
Convert your bank statements into downloadable CSV files in seconds. This feature ensures that users can instantly access their financial data, drastically reducing the time spent on manual entry and increasing productivity.
Support for Multi-page and Batch Uploads
ProcessBankStatement allows users to upload multi-page PDFs and multiple files simultaneously, making it ideal for those who handle large volumes of statements. This feature streamlines the process further, enabling users to manage their workload efficiently.
High Accuracy Rate
With an impressive accuracy rate of over 99%, our tool guarantees that the data extracted from bank statements is reliable and precise. This feature is crucial for professionals who need to ensure the integrity of financial records for analysis or reporting.
Secure Data Handling
Security is paramount when dealing with sensitive financial information. ProcessBankStatement employs encryption during file transfers and offers users full control over their data, including the option to delete files at any time. This feature provides peace of mind for all users.
Use Cases
Invoice Guru
On-Site Invoice Generation
Tradespeople can generate invoices on-site immediately after completing a job. This capability allows for quick billing and enhances customer satisfaction by providing clients with instant documentation of services rendered, facilitating faster payments.
Expense Management for Small Businesses
Small service businesses can leverage the OCR receipt scanning feature to manage expenses efficiently. By digitizing receipts in seconds, users can maintain accurate financial records without spending hours on manual data entry, which is especially beneficial for busy professionals.
Compliance with Tax Regulations
Invoice Guru is designed to keep users compliant with necessary tax regulations, such as the UK MTD and Poland's KSeF. This feature is crucial for tradespeople who may not have extensive accounting knowledge but need to ensure their invoicing practices meet legal standards.
Multilingual and Multi-Currency Support
For tradespeople operating in diverse markets, Invoice Guru supports over 12 languages and multiple currencies. This feature enables users to cater to an international clientele, making it easier to conduct business across borders without language or currency barriers.
ProcessBankStatement
Accountant Workflow Optimization
Accountants can utilize ProcessBankStatement to quickly convert their clients' bank statements into structured data, allowing for faster reconciliations and financial analysis. This efficiency significantly reduces the time spent on preparing reports.
Small Business Financial Management
Small business owners can streamline their bookkeeping processes by using our tool to convert bank statements into CSV files. This enables them to easily import transaction data into accounting software, simplifying financial tracking and reporting.
Tax Preparation Simplification
Tax preparers can leverage ProcessBankStatement to handle multiple clients' bank statements effortlessly. By converting lengthy statements into organized data quickly, they can focus on providing valuable insights rather than getting bogged down in data entry.
Loan Application Processing
Loan officers can enhance their ability to review bank statements for loan applications by using our tool. The quick conversion of statements into structured formats allows for faster assessments and improved customer service during the loan approval process.
Overview
About Invoice Guru
Invoice Guru is a revolutionary mobile-first invoicing application designed specifically for tradespeople and small service businesses. Unlike traditional invoicing tools that are often desktop-centric, Invoice Guru allows users to create and send invoices directly from their mobile devices, making it an ideal solution for professionals such as painters, plumbers, electricians, and other tradespeople who operate on-site and need immediate invoicing capabilities. The app emphasizes speed, simplicity, and automation, enabling users to generate invoices in as little as 60 seconds, track payment statuses, and reduce administrative burdens. With features like automatic accountant reports, integrated bank connections for payment matching, and OCR receipt scanning for expense management, Invoice Guru significantly streamlines the invoicing process. It is also built to comply with evolving regulations, such as the UK MTD and Poland's KSeF, ensuring that users remain compliant without the hassle of switching tools. Created by a tradesperson who understands the daily challenges of running a small business, Invoice Guru is not merely an accounting tool; it is a comprehensive solution that enhances productivity and efficiency for those in the trades.
About ProcessBankStatement
ProcessBankStatement is an innovative web-based tool specifically designed to transform cumbersome and often chaotic bank statement PDFs into clean, organized data in a matter of seconds. It serves as a reliable solution for finance professionals, accountants, bookkeepers, small business owners, and anyone who frequently interacts with financial data. By simply uploading any PDF bank statement—whether it is sourced from an online banking portal or is a scanned image of a physical document—users can effectively eliminate the tedious task of manual data entry. Our advanced parsing engine quickly processes the uploaded statements, delivering a neatly structured CSV file that is ready for immediate use in popular platforms like QuickBooks and Excel. The main value proposition of ProcessBankStatement is its ability to reclaim valuable hours in your workweek by automating a frustrating manual process. With an accuracy rate exceeding 99%, it is fast, exceptionally reliable, and ensures users maintain complete control over their data. We proudly support statements from all major U.S. banks, including Chase, Bank of America, and Wells Fargo, making our tool accessible to a broad audience.
Frequently Asked Questions
Invoice Guru FAQ
How does Invoice Guru ensure compliance with tax regulations?
Invoice Guru is built with features that align with evolving tax regulations, including the UK MTD and Poland's KSeF. This ensures that users can manage their invoicing and reporting without worrying about compliance issues.
Can I use Invoice Guru for multiple currencies?
Yes, Invoice Guru supports multi-currency transactions. Users can easily create invoices in various currencies, making it suitable for businesses that deal with international clients.
Is there a limit to the number of invoices I can create?
The free Starter Plan allows users to create up to 10 invoices. For users needing more, the Basic and Pro plans offer unlimited invoice creation, making it flexible for businesses of all sizes.
How does the OCR receipt scanner work?
The OCR receipt scanner uses AI technology to read and extract details from your receipts when you take a photo. It automatically saves the information as an expense entry, saving you time and reducing the likelihood of errors in your expense tracking.
ProcessBankStatement FAQ
What file types are supported?
Currently, ProcessBankStatement supports PDF bank statements, including both text-based and scanned files. This flexibility allows users to work with various document types without hassle.
Can I upload scanned images or photos?
Yes! The tool fully supports scanned PDFs and image-based statements, providing users with a seamless experience regardless of how their bank statements are provided.
Is there a free trial?
Absolutely! Guests can convert 3 pages per day at no cost, while registered users can enjoy 5 free pages daily. This allows users to test the tool before committing to a subscription.
Is my data secure?
Yes, your data is treated with the utmost security. Files are encrypted during transfer, and users have complete control over their information, including the ability to delete files whenever they choose.
Alternatives
Invoice Guru Alternatives
Invoice Guru is a mobile-first invoicing application that caters specifically to tradespeople and small service businesses in the UK. It streamlines the invoicing process, allowing users to create compliant invoices quickly and efficiently, which is essential for professionals who are often on-site. As businesses grow or evolve, users frequently seek alternatives to Invoice Guru for various reasons, including pricing structures, additional features, or specific platform compatibility. When evaluating alternatives, it's important to consider factors such as ease of use, compliance with regulations, integration capabilities, customer support, and overall value for money. Finding the right invoicing solution is crucial for maintaining financial health and operational efficiency. Users should assess their unique business needs, including the types of services they provide, their billing frequency, and their familiarity with technology. A suitable alternative should offer flexibility, enhanced features that support business growth, and the ability to adapt to changing regulatory requirements while ensuring a seamless user experience.
ProcessBankStatement Alternatives
ProcessBankStatement is an innovative web-based tool designed to convert PDF bank statements into structured CSV files efficiently and accurately. As a member of the business and finance category, it caters to finance professionals and individuals who deal with financial data regularly. Users often seek alternatives for various reasons, including pricing structures, specific features, or compatibility with their existing platforms. When choosing an alternative, it is essential to consider factors such as processing speed, data security, supported file types, and the level of accuracy in data extraction to ensure it meets your unique needs.